About McDonough-Guice-Custer
McDonough-Guice-Custer is a collection of quiet residential streets in southeast Atlanta, often overlooked by buyers focused on more established neighborhoods. The area offers some of the city’s most affordable intown housing, with tree-lined streets and a slower pace than neighborhoods closer to the Atlanta Beltline.
The planned SE Beltline Southside Trail will eventually connect this area to the broader trail network, potentially catalyzing investment similar to what happened along the Eastside Trail.
Real Estate in McDonough-Guice-Custer
The housing stock consists primarily of mid-century bungalows and ranch homes, many available below $250,000. Investors and first-time buyers seeking affordability find options here that have largely disappeared from neighborhoods further north.
Renovation activity is beginning as buyers discover the value proposition.
Living in McDonough-Guice-Custer
This is a quiet, car-dependent neighborhood without the walkable amenities of more developed areas. Residents value the affordable housing, low density, and proximity to downtown without downtown prices. The future SE Beltline Southside Trail connection promises to transform accessibility.
